List the eight most common elements in Earth's crust.

Describe a simple chemical test that is useful in identifying the mineral calcite.

Answer to Question 1

Oxygen, silicon, aluminum, iron, calcium, sodium, potassium, and magnesium.

Answer to Question 2

Calcite is a carbonate mineral, which is a mineral group most readily identified by the effervescent reaction to a drop of dilute hydrochloric acid.
